Abstract EN

The structural features and morphology of investigated Sb2S3 powder were analyzed by X-ray diffraction and scanning electron microscope techniques.

The dependence of dielectric properties and ac conductivity of bulk Sb2S3 as pellet on both of frequency (102–106 Hz) and temperature (303-393 K) were studied.

The dielectric constant (121.2-45.8) and dielectric loss (53.3-0.89) displayed noticeable dependence on frequency and in the investigated range of temperature 303-393 K.

The frequency dependence of ac conductivity σac(ω) follows up the power relation; σac(ω) = Gωs.

The frequency exponent s, diminished with the rise in temperature, implying that the correlated barrier hopping (CBH) is the predominant conduction mechanism.

The ac conductivity exhibited a thermally activated nature.

The localized states N(EF) values recorded in order of 1018 eV-1.

cm-3 at specific temperatures for frequency of 800 Hz.

Activation energy ΔE, calculated at different frequencies indicating a decrease from 117 meV to 89 meV with the increase in the frequency.
